### `find`

#### Description

Returns the starting index of the `occurrence`th occurrence of the substring `pattern`
in the input string `string`.
Default value of `occurrence` is set to `1`.
If `consider_overlapping` is not provided or is set to `.true.` the function counts two overlapping occurrences of substring as two different occurrences.
If `occurrence`th occurrence is not found, function returns `0`.


#### Syntax

`string = [[stdlib_strings(module):find(interface)]] (string, pattern, occurrence, consider_overlapping)`

#### Status

Experimental

#### Class

Elemental function

#### Argument

- `string`: Character scalar or [[stdlib_string_type(module):string_type(type)]].
This argument is intent(in).
- `pattern`: Character scalar or [[stdlib_string_type(module):string_type(type)]].
This argument is intent(in).
- `occurrence`: integer.
This argument is intent(in) and optional.
- `consider_overlapping`: logical.
This argument is intent(in) and optional.

#### Result value

The result is a scalar of integer type or integer array of rank equal to the highest rank among all dummy arguments.

#### Example

```fortran
program demo_find
use stdlib_string_type
use stdlib_strings, only : find
implicit none
string_type :: string

string = "needle in the character-stack"

print *, find(string, "needle") ! 1
print *, find(string, ["a", "c"], [3, 2]) ! [27, 20]
print *, find("qwqwqwq", "qwq", 3, [.false., .true.]) ! [0, 5]

end program demo_find
```

!> Returns the starting index of the 'occurrence'th occurrence of substring 'pattern'
!> in input 'string'
!> Returns an integer
elemental function find_char_char(string, pattern, occurrence, consider_overlapping) result(res)
character(len=*), intent(in) :: string
character(len=*), intent(in) :: pattern
integer, intent(in), optional :: occurrence
logical, intent(in), optional :: consider_overlapping
integer :: lps_array(len(pattern))
integer :: res, s_i, p_i, length_string, length_pattern, occurrence_
logical :: consider_overlapping_

consider_overlapping_ = optval(consider_overlapping, .true.)
occurrence_ = optval(occurrence, 1)
res = 0
length_string = len(string)
length_pattern = len(pattern)

if (length_pattern > 0 .and. length_pattern <= length_string &
& .and. occurrence_ > 0) then
lps_array = compute_lps(pattern)

s_i = 1
p_i = 1
do while(s_i <= length_string)
if (string(s_i:s_i) == pattern(p_i:p_i)) then
if (p_i == length_pattern) then
occurrence_ = occurrence_ - 1
if (occurrence_ == 0) then
res = s_i - length_pattern + 1
exit
else if (consider_overlapping_) then
p_i = lps_array(p_i)
else
p_i = 0
end if
end if
s_i = s_i + 1
p_i = p_i + 1
else if (p_i > 1) then
p_i = lps_array(p_i - 1) + 1
else
s_i = s_i + 1
end if
end do
end if

end function find_char_char

!> Computes longest prefix suffix for each index of the input 'string'
!>
!> Returns an array of integers
pure function compute_lps(string) result(lps_array)
character(len=*), intent(in) :: string
integer :: lps_array(len(string))
integer :: i, j, length_string

length_string = len(string)

if (length_string > 0) then
lps_array(1) = 0

i = 2
j = 1
do while (i <= length_string)
if (string(j:j) == string(i:i)) then
lps_array(i) = j
i = i + 1
j = j + 1
else if (j > 1) then
j = lps_array(j - 1) + 1
else
lps_array(i) = 0
i = i + 1
end if
end do
end if

end function compute_lps
